The City of Battle Ground will open the Battle Ground Community Center as a cooling center from 8:00 am – 9:00 pm on Monday, July 1st through Wednesday, July 3rd.
The National Weather Service has issued a statement regarding their expectation for high temperatures and humidity in the region, with the possibility of temperatures reaching the century mark on Monday and Tuesday.
Those needing a respite from the heat are invited to spend time in the City’s air-conditioned Community Center located at 912 East Main Street in Battle Ground. Visitors are encouraged to bring picnic meals, books, magazines, board games and activities for children. Wi-Fi will be available for those wanting to use mobile devices.
